Daniel, Will and Elliott have been on the road for over two and a half months. They have traversed mountain passes along the Cascade Range in Washington, battled 100-degree heat in the plains of central Oregon and breathed fresh salt water air all cycling down the California Coast.
The successes of SWAE Sports on this West Coast cycling tour can’t just be measured in number of cities or outfitters the team have met, but from the experiences, the adventures, the people and the entire journey itself.
2,500 miles by bike to launch a company says it all and if it doesn’t, the above slideshow will paint a picture of the adventures SWAE Sports went through to promote conservation through adventure.
